Sinopsis
In Book 2 of War and Peace tensions rise as Napoleon’s army advances toward Russia. Pierre Bezukhov, inheriting a vast fortune, struggles with his newfound status and searches for meaning in chaotic high society. Prince Andrei Bolkonsky, disillusioned with family life after his wife’s death, eagerly rejoins the military, hoping to find purpose in war. The Rostov family experiences both joy and hardship: Nikolai gambles away their money, while Natasha blossoms into a spirited young woman. Tolstoy contrasts personal dramas with the grandeur of war, exploring themes of fate, ambition, and the human condition. As battles loom, characters grapple with their roles in an unfolding destiny.
